Premium Compact Cameras Return to Viewfinders Amid Screen Visibility Complaints

Panasonic's new Lumix L10 adds an electronic viewfinder to its 26.5MP Micro Four Thirds compact, marking a market shift away from rear-screen-only designs. Enthusiasts have long preferred eye-level composition for stability and visibility, especially in bright outdoor conditions where rear screens fade. The move signals manufacturers are reconsidering the screen-first approach that dominated compact design over the past decade as premium segment buyers prioritize usability over pure portability.
